Biography of Screech

Screech Powers, portrayed by Dustin Diamond, first appeared in the pilot episode of "Saved by the Bell" in 1989. He quickly became known for his nerdy persona, distinctive voice, and unforgettable catchphrases. Screech was a loyal friend to Zach Morris, Kelly Kapowski, and the rest of the gang, often finding himself in humorous and awkward situations that resonated with viewers.

Character Development

Screech's character evolved significantly throughout the series. Initially portrayed as the quintessential nerd, he often faced bullying and social challenges. However, as the series progressed, the writers began to develop more depth to his character, showcasing his intelligence and creativity.

Early Seasons

In the early seasons, Screech's character was primarily used for comic relief. He had a crush on Lisa Turtle and often found himself in embarrassing situations. His catchphrase, "Whoa!" became synonymous with his character, adding to his charm.

Later Seasons

As "Saved by the Bell" continued, Screech was given more significant storylines, including episodes that focused on his inventions and his dreams of becoming a filmmaker. These developments allowed audiences to see a more well-rounded character who was not just a nerd but a talented individual with aspirations.

Merchandising and Spin-offs

Due to the show's popularity, Screech and other characters were featured in various merchandise, including toys, apparel, and lunchboxes. Additionally, Screech's character appeared in several spin-offs, including "Saved by the Bell: The College Years" and "Saved by the Bell: The New Class," further solidifying his presence in pop culture.

Dustin Diamond's Career

Dustin Diamond's portrayal of Screech propelled him to fame, but it also came with challenges. After "Saved by the Bell," Diamond struggled to find roles that matched his early success. He appeared in various television shows and movies, but none reached the same level of acclaim.

Reality Television and Controversies

In later years, Diamond turned to reality television, participating in shows like "Celebrity Fit Club" and "The Celebrity Apprentice." However, he also faced controversies, including legal issues and a tell-all book that drew criticism from former co-stars.

Reboots and Revivals

In recent years, the franchise has seen reboots and revivals, introducing beloved characters to a new audience. The 2020 reboot of "Saved by the Bell" brought back some original cast members, including a cameo by Screech, highlighting the character's lasting impact on the series.

Challenges Faced by Dustin Diamond

Despite his initial success, Dustin Diamond faced numerous challenges in his personal and professional life. His struggles with typecasting and public perception often overshadowed his achievements. Sadly, he passed away in February 2021, leaving behind a complicated legacy that reflects the ups and downs of fame.
